Australia - Import of Sacks and Bags of Polyethylene or Polypropylene
Since 2014, Australia Import of Sacks and Bags of Polyethylene or Polypropylene was up 9.7% year on year. With $55,600,321.16 in 2019, the country was ranked number 14 comparing other countries in Import of Sacks and Bags of Polyethylene or Polypropylene. Australia is overtaken by Poland, which was ranked number 13 with $59,290,292 and is followed by Malaysia at $51,269,176.98. United States lead the ranking with $637,269,703.7 in 2019, -1.6% compared to 2018. Japan, Germany and South Korea resp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Myanmar recorded the best 5 years average growth at +219.8% per year, while Sao Tome and Principe was the worst growing country at -55% per year.
